So I have been going by the text book. I used to be so good at it once upon a time. My old incubator bit the dust (little giant still air) so I upgraded to the new digital little giant. I also got a Hoovabator still air now. Trying to hatch silkie eggs and paid a lot of money for 30 eggs and only 14 made it.
-I hand turn my eggs with clean hands 3 times a day.
-I try to keep my incubator at 45-60% 99-101degrees
before day 18. Candling them on day 7 and 14.
-lock down at day 18 60-70% 99-101degrees (maybe I should locked them down sooner some started pipping at day 19 silkie eggs)
* I just ordered more eggs they aren’t cheap imma try it again but before I get them I need advice and help.. they aren’t shipped local pickup.
I’ve been reading about a dry hatch vs a wet hatch any advice please help.
